Waldfreibad Heidenheim, Outdoor swimming complex in Heidenheim, Germany
Waldfreibad Heidenheim is an outdoor swimming complex with multiple pools of different sizes set within a forested area. The grounds feature a large lap pool, a diving section, shallow areas for children, and spacious lawn areas for sunbathing.
The facility was established as a recreational area for the community and developed over decades into a popular gathering place. It became the location where generations of residents learned to swim and spent their summers.
The location sits nestled within forest surroundings and functions as an extension of visitors' outdoor routines in the region. Families combine swimming with walks through the surrounding woods.
Access is possible by car or public transport, with the forest setting providing shaded pathways throughout the grounds. Visitors should arrive early on hot days to secure a good spot on the lawn areas.
The pools maintain different water temperatures, allowing visitors with varying preferences to choose their preferred section. The warmest pool is primarily used by young children and differs noticeably from the cooler lap pool.
